Understanding infant and toddler behavior can be a challenge. But this book provides teachers with a more thorough understanding of the knowledge base that informs early childhood practice. Innovations gives you an in-depth guide to the underlying ages and stages, theories, and best practices of the early childhood field which begins to address these challenging behaviors in developmentally appropriate ways.

Acerca del autor
Kay Albrecht, Ph.D. is a senior partner in a consulting firm that specializes in working with businesses interested in family-friendly policies and in supporting early education. Dr. Albrecht is a nationally know speaker, the author of several books, and a contributing editor to Child Care Information Exchange. Linda Miller has been committed to the field of education for more than 25 years--as a classroom teacher, supervisor, federal projects director, trainer, corporate child care director, and curriculum developer. She is a nationally know speaker and a highly sought-after consultant to early childhood programs throughout the country.
